defiled
adjectivedi-FILED
meaning in plain English
Made dirty or unclean.
Think a holy altar, then imagine graffiti sprayed over it—now it's defiled.
for example
The kids defiled the playground by dumping soda cans everywhere.
If someone tosses garbage onto a clean sidewalk, they have defiled it, turning a tidy spot into a mess. It’s the same as making something filthy.
